THE SYNTHESIS OF UNEQUALLY SPACED ARRAYS BY GENETIC ALGORITHM COMBINED WITH SIMULATED ANNEALING
|
Abstract:
A new type of genetic algorithm combined the parallel simulated annealing with the advantages of guaranteeing convergence and deciding convergence easily was proposed to the synthesis of unequally spaced arrays. The position and the weighted coefficients can optimize at the same time. The cases showed that this method has strong ability to find the global optimization solution. This method provides a strong tool to the design of the large antenna arrays.
